CA
Carrentals.co.uk
View company profile →
Used carrentals .co.uk many times
Used carrentals .co.uk many times never had a problem with them or the rental companies I have used on their platform
View company profile →
Used carrentals .co.uk many times never had a problem with them or the rental companies I have used on their platform